One of the internal factors that affect rate of transpiration is:

Options

  • Age of leaf

  • Colour of leaf

  • Sunken stomata

  • Light

MCQ
Advertisements

Solution

Sunken stomata

Explanation:

Sunken stomata is an internal structural adaptation of the leaf (common in desert plants) that helps reduce water loss by trapping a pocket of humid air outside the stomata, thereby lowering the rate of transpiration. Light is an external factor.
